CI note — EXIF scrubbing stage (Pixelvane pipeline)

If the scrub-exif job fails on PNGs, it's almost always the probe step misreading text chunks as EXIF. Rerun with strict mode off first. JPEG failures are real: check that the stripped output actually lost GPS tags before retrying. Don't skip the stage to unblock a build. Include in your report the scrubber's trace token, printed below.

session token of tajef-bageg = htk21_5d90d574934f3ccae6437

Action item from the Gristmill outage. The balancer kept routing to a wedged node because health checks only hit the ping endpoint, not the worker queue. Support saw timeouts for 40 minutes before drain. Fix: checks now exercise a real query path and nodes fail out after consecutive misses. If customers report slow responses post-deploy, check ejection counts first. The tuned health-check constants, effective next rollout, are as follows.

tuning table, kajog-bawip:
TIERS = {
    "kelius": 256,
    "lammir": 543,
}

## Deployment

The revamped reset flow (Rekey v2) replaces the legacy token emailer. Deploys go through the staging ring first; smoke tests cover token issuance, expiry, and the rate limiter. Do not deploy Rekey and the mailer service in the same window — token format mismatches will lock users out. Feature flag stays off until the mailer confirms the new template. After the flag flips, verify the service picked up the following configuration values.

settings of kahap-kahof:
[aldvan]
port = 6379
team = istox
host = aldvan.plorvalabs.internal
region = west-1
access_code = ac_e12344
timeout_ms = 2000

- [ ] **Step 7: Breaker override escrow.** After sealing the signing keys for the Tallgrove upstream API circuit breaker, confirm the support team can force the breaker open during a full outage. The override bundle lives in the sealed escrow drawer and is useless without its unlock phrase. Two ceremony witnesses must initial this step before proceeding. The escrow bundle is decrypted with the recovery passphrase that follows.

vault phrase of kahip-kahop = holath-quenmir